Class Central is learner-supported. When you buy through links on our site, we may earn an affiliate commission.

YouTube

Jetpack Navigation 3 API Overview

Android Developers via YouTube

Overview

Coursera Flash Sale
40% Off Coursera Plus for 3 Months!
Grab it
Explore Jetpack Navigation 3, Google's latest library for building navigation in Android applications through this 25-minute conference talk. Master the fundamentals of using keys to represent navigable content, managing back stacks effectively, and creating NavEntry objects to contain your Composable content. Dive into practical coding walkthroughs that demonstrate API basics and learn how to modularize your navigation code for better project organization across multiple modules. Discover techniques for customizing screen animations to enhance user experience and implement adaptive layouts using Scenes to accommodate various device configurations. Follow along with hands-on demonstrations covering multi-module navigation implementation, animation customization, and adaptive layout creation. Access comprehensive documentation and code recipes to support your learning and implementation of Navigation 3 in your Android development projects.

Syllabus

0:00 - Nav3 basics
2:09 - Defining content with NavEntry and entryProvider
3:29 - API basics - coding walkthrough
7:17 - Multi-module Navigation
11:27 - Modularization - coding walkthrough
15:57 - Animating between screens
16:15 - Animations - coding walkthrough
19:44 - Adaptive layouts using Scenes
23:01 - Adaptive layouts - coding walkthrough
24:39 - Recap

Taught by

Android Developers

Reviews

Start your review of Jetpack Navigation 3 API Overview

Never Stop Learning.

Get personalized course recommendations, track subjects and courses with reminders, and more.

Someone learning on their laptop while sitting on the floor.